Polenta


To prepare the polenta, put a pot on the stove with about 2 quarts of salted water and bring to a boil.
Add a tablespoon of extra virgin olive oil and slowly add 1/2 kg of yellow maize flour to avoid lumps; mix well with a wooden spoon or with a whisk.
Stir well from the bottom up; if you see the polenta starts to get too hard soften it with a ladle of hot water.
Continue stirring regularly for about 40 minutes, until it begins to peel away from the edge of the pot. When cooked, pour the polenta on the traditional wooden cutting board and serve hot.
If you want to make it even more delicious sautéed mushrooms and parsley mixed with olive oil and place them on top of the polenta. With a glass of red wine dish is served!
